Understanding Your 2024 Honda Odyssey Oil Change Interval System
Modern vehicles, including your 2024 Honda Odyssey, are incredibly sophisticated. Gone are the days of a simple “every 3,000 miles” rule for oil changes. Honda has implemented an advanced system to help you determine the optimal time for service: the Maintenance Minder.
This intelligent system doesn’t just track mileage. It actively monitors various driving conditions, engine operating temperatures, and even oil degradation. The Maintenance Minder is designed to give you a personalized oil change schedule based on how you actually drive.
How the Maintenance Minder Works
The Maintenance Minder display is located on your instrument panel. It uses a series of codes to indicate when service is due. When your oil life drops to 15%, a “Service Due Soon” message will appear, along with a main item (A or B) and sub-items (1 through 7).
- Service Due Soon (15% Oil Life): This is your initial warning. Plan to get your oil changed soon.
- Service Due Now (5% Oil Life): Don’t delay. Schedule your service immediately.
- Service Past Due (0% Oil Life): You’re overdue. Get the service done as soon as possible to prevent potential engine wear.
For a 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val, the primary codes you’ll see are “A” or “B” for oil changes, often accompanied by a “1” for tire rotation.
- Service A: Replace engine oil.
- Service B: Replace engine oil and oil filter, inspect various components (brakes, tie rods, suspension, exhaust system, fluid levels, etc.).
Always refer to your Odyssey’s owner’s manual for a complete breakdown of all Maintenance Minder codes and recommended services.

The Official 2024 Honda Odyssey Oil Change Interval: What the Manual Says
While the Maintenance Minder is your primary guide, it’s good to understand the baseline. For most normal driving conditions, the 2024 Honda Odyssey typically recommends an oil change when the Maintenance Minder indicates 15% oil life remaining, which often falls between 7,500 and 10,000 miles, or about 12 months, whichever comes first.
However, your driving habits play a huge role. If you frequently engage in “severe service” conditions, your Maintenance Minder will likely trigger oil changes more often. What constitutes severe service?
- Frequent short trips (less than 5-10 miles) where the engine doesn’t fully warm up.
- Driving in extremely hot or cold temperatures.
- Idling for extended periods.
- Towing heavy loads (though the Odyssey isn’t primarily a tow vehicle, it’s worth noting).
- Driving in dusty conditions.
If you fit any of these descriptions, don’t be surprised if your 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val is shorter than someone who primarily drives long highway miles. Always trust the Maintenance Minder first. It’s designed to account for these variables.
Choosing the Right Oil & Filter for Your 2024 Odyssey
When it’s time for an oil change, using the correct type and viscosity of oil is paramount. Honda specifically recommends:
- Oil Type: Use only synthetic motor oil.
- Viscosity: 0W-20 is the recommended viscosity for your 2024 Honda Odyssey.
Always look for oil that meets Honda’s specifications, typically indicated by a certification from the American Petroleum Institute (API) with the “starburst” symbol and the ILSAC GF-6 standard. Using the wrong oil can negatively impact engine performance, fuel economy, and longevity.
For the oil filter, stick with a high-quality filter. Many DIYers prefer OEM Honda oil filters for their proven reliability and fitment. Brands like Wix, Mann, and Purolator also offer excellent aftermarket alternatives. A good filter is crucial for trapping contaminants and keeping your oil clean throughout the 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val.
How to Perform a 2024 Honda Odyssey Oil Change: A DIY Guide
For the weekend warrior or dedicated DIYer, changing the oil on your 2024 Honda Odyssey is a straightforward job. It’s a great way to save money and get intimately familiar with your vehicle. Remember, safety first!
Tools and Parts You’ll Need:
- New 0W-20 Full Synthetic Motor Oil (approximately 5.7 quarts for the 3.5L V6).
- New Oil Filter (e.g., Honda OEM part number 15400-PLM-A02 or equivalent).
- Oil Filter Wrench (cap-style, typically 64.5mm with 14 flutes).
- Socket Wrench with a 17mm socket for the drain plug.
- New Crush Washer for the drain plug (Honda OEM part number 94109-14000).
- Drain Pan (8-quart capacity or larger).
- Funnel.
- Clean Rags or Shop Towels.
- Gloves (nitrile or similar).
- Jack and Jack Stands (or ramps) – NEVER work under a vehicle supported only by a jack.
- Wheel Chocks.
Step-by-Step 2024 Honda Odyssey Oil Change Interval Best Practices:
Step 1: Prepare the Vehicle Safely
- Park your Odyssey on a flat, level surface.
- Engage the parking brake.
- Place wheel chocks behind the rear wheels.
- Carefully jack up the front of the vehicle and support it securely with jack stands. Ensure the vehicle is stable before proceeding.
Step 2: Drain the Old Oil
- Locate the oil pan and drain plug underneath the engine. It’s usually a 17mm bolt.
- Place your drain pan directly beneath the drain plug.
- Using your 17mm socket wrench, loosen the drain plug. Be prepared, as oil will start to flow quickly once loosened.
- Remove the plug completely (and the old crush washer) and let the oil drain fully. This usually takes 5-10 minutes.
Step 3: Replace the Oil Filter
- While the oil is draining, locate the oil filter. It’s usually on the front side of the engine block.
- Place your drain pan under the filter, as more oil will come out.
- Use your oil filter wrench to loosen the old filter. Once it’s loose, you can often unscrew it by hand.
- Ensure the old rubber gasket from the filter came off with it. If not, remove it from the engine block.
- Apply a thin film of new oil to the rubber gasket of your new oil filter.
- Screw on the new filter by hand until the gasket makes contact with the engine block, then tighten it another 3/4 to 1 full turn. Do not overtighten.
Step 4: Refill with Fresh Oil
- Once the old oil has finished draining, clean the area around the drain plug opening.
- Install a new crush washer onto the drain plug and reinsert the plug.
- Tighten the drain plug to the manufacturer’s specified torque (usually around 29 lb-ft or 39 Nm). Do not overtighten, as this can strip the threads.
- Lower your Odyssey off the jack stands.
- Open the hood and remove the oil filler cap.
- Place a funnel into the oil filler opening.
- Pour in approximately 5.5 quarts of the new 0W-20 synthetic oil.
- Replace the oil filler cap.
Step 5: Check and Reset
- Start the engine and let it run for a minute or two. This allows the new oil to circulate and the filter to fill.
- Turn off the engine and wait for 5 minutes for the oil to settle.
- Pull out the dipstick, wipe it clean, reinsert it fully, and then pull it out again to check the oil level. It should be between the “min” and “max” marks. Add more oil in small increments if needed until the level is correct.
- Reset the Maintenance Minder system. This is crucial for accurate future 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val tips. The procedure is typically found in your owner’s manual but usually involves navigating through the instrument cluster menus using the steering wheel controls. Look for “Vehicle Settings” -> “Maintenance Info” -> “Reset.”
- Inspect for any leaks around the drain plug and oil filter.
Proper disposal of used oil is important for a sustainable 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val. Many auto parts stores and service stations accept used oil for recycling. Never pour it down a drain or dispose of it in regular trash.
Beyond the Interval: Monitoring Your Odyssey’s Oil Health
While the Maintenance Minder is excellent, periodic checks are still a smart move for any conscientious owner. Regular checks can catch potential issues early, helping you avoid common problems with your 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val.
Routine Oil Level Checks
Make it a habit to check your oil level once a month, or before a long road trip. This simple check takes less than a minute and can prevent serious engine damage due to low oil. Remember to check the oil when the engine is warm but has been off for at least 5 minutes to allow oil to drain back into the pan.
What to Look For
- Oil Level: As mentioned, ensure it’s between the “min” and “max” marks on the dipstick.
- Oil Color: New oil is golden. Over time, it darkens as it picks up contaminants. Very dark or black oil, especially if it smells burnt, is a sign it’s time for a change, even if the Maintenance Minder hasn’t triggered yet.
- Oil Texture/Consistency: It should be smooth. If it feels gritty or looks milky (which could indicate coolant contamination), get it checked immediately by a professional.
- Debris: Look for any metal flakes or unusual particles on the dipstick, which could signal internal engine wear.

Frequently Asked Questions About Your 2024 Honda Odyssey Oil Change Interval
What type of oil does a 2024 Honda Odyssey take?
Your 2024 Honda Odyssey requires 0W-20 full synthetic motor oil. Always ensure the oil meets API certification and ILSAC GF-6 standards as specified in your owner’s manual.
How often should I change the oil in my 2024 Honda Odyssey?
The primary guide for your 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val is the Maintenance Minder system. It will typically recommend an oil change between 7,500 and 10,000 miles, or about 12 months, based on your driving conditions, when the oil life reaches 15%.
Can I use conventional oil in my 2024 Honda Odyssey?
No, Honda specifically recommends full synthetic 0W-20 motor oil for the 2024 Odyssey. Using conventional oil may not provide adequate protection, could affect fuel economy, and might even void parts of your warranty.
What happens if I go over the recommended oil change interval?
Exceeding the recommended 2024 Honda Odyssey oil change interval can lead to oil breakdown, reduced lubrication, sludge buildup, and increased engine wear. This can result in decreased performance, lower fuel economy, and eventually, costly engine damage or failure.
How do I reset the oil life light on my 2024 Honda Odyssey?
After performing an oil change, you’ll need to reset the Maintenance Minder. The exact steps vary slightly by trim, but generally involve navigating to the “Vehicle Settings” or “Maintenance Info” menu on your instrument cluster using the steering wheel controls and selecting “Reset.” Refer to your owner’s manual for precise instructions.
